Transaction 743766e4beb33f76be281c95973fe22032e444cb8962f821f1038af3acf55864
1 Input
1 Output
-
743766e4beb33f76be281c95973fe22032e444cb8962f821f1038af3acf55864:0
- value
- 264869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b13cb201125d5e3cae836899c71fa7f4663bcbb0 OP_EQUAL
- address
- 3HrAEgaGP3avVNVrJF9DWX4E7aL9xNrqR4